Symptom #4: Dyspareunia

Dyspareunia refers to painful sexual intercourse that may have occurred due to psychological or medical causes. The pain differs and can be felt in the external surface or deeper pelvis when there is pressure against the cervix.

There are many causes that can contribute to dyspareunia such as from psychological, physical, relationship, or social causes. In cancer, dyspareunia is seen in cervical cancer, uterine cancer, ovarian cancer, and vaginal cancer. However, it is one of the less common signs in endometrial cancer.
